The peacock in the Bible represents wealth and prosperity and is often associated with emperors and kings. Goose The goose represents providence and vigilance. Lark WebTHE PEACOCK. The peacock is first mentioned in the Bible in the time of Solomon. He. used to send his vessels to distant countries, and they came back once. in three years, "bringing gold, and silver, and ivory, and apes, and. peacocks." Solomon was the richest among all the kings that the Bible. tells us about.

WebThe peacock in Byzantine and early Romanesque art was used to signify the Resurrection, because its flesh was thought to be incorruptible. ( St. Augustine, City of God, xxi, c, iv.) It was also a symbol of pride. The raven is a symbol of the Jews of confession and penance. The cock is a symbol of vigilance, and also an emblem of St. Peter.
